包含在启动程序时从命令行传入的参数的参数向量。在main方法中使用,与argc一起使用。
Python 列表到字符串操作。在各自单独的行上打印每个命令行 argv“--option argument1 argument2”
我有一个有效的解决方案,但它太糟糕了。我经常写这样的东西,然后只是厌恶地看着它,但是这个就太恶心了……尤其是因为它只是列表到字符串
我正在学习 CS50 的 Python 编程简介。对于当前的问题,我应该编写一个程序,其中涉及: 需要零或两个命令行参数: 泽...
我编写了一个小程序,它从 *argv[] 获取一些输入参数并打印它们。在几乎所有用例中,我的代码都运行得很好。仅当我使用多个时才会出现问题
我有一个Python脚本,它将参数“-i on”传递给主定义中的argv 这是代码的一部分; def main(argv): 状态=“无” 尝试: opts, args = getopt.getopt(
我制作了名为“qsort.txt”的文本文件,并在文件中写入了任意多个整数(在我的例子中,准确地说是 35 个整数)。我的目标是计算该文件中有多少个整数,将其放入...
如果argc为1,我还可以使用argv[1],argv[2],...字符数组吗?
如果没有从命令行传递参数,即。如果 argc 为 1,我们是否仍然可以为 argv[1]、argv[2]、..... 分配内存,并使用这些缓冲区进行进一步的实验。 如果这是未定义的...
我习惯性地使用“sys.argv[1:]”作为参数输入,但突然提出了一个问题。 sys.argv[0] 始终返回自身。如果我的文件名是“aaa.py”,那么 argv[0] 就是 &
当我执行此脚本时,./cat-itself.sh 会将自身打印到标准输出,而无需我从终端显式为其提供任何位置参数: #!/usr/bin/bash 猫“0美元” 怎么...
我有一个 std::string ,其中包含要使用 execv 执行的命令,将其转换为 execv() 第二个参数所需的“char *argv[]”的最佳“C++”方法是什么? 为了澄清...
我不知道为什么我的 Windows PC 中的命令提示符无法运行我的 python 脚本,即使添加了 shebang 行“#! python3' 用于 Windows。 一直说 python 无法打开文件 [errno 2...
命令行参数未正确传递,argc 始终返回 1,而 argc 在 Visual Studio C++ 上返回空指针
我最近正在为一个班级做一个项目,在传递命令行参数时遇到很多问题。我决定用我在极客网上找到的一个非常简单的代码进行测试......
我正在尝试获取 x86 汇编语言中存储在 argv[1] 中的第一个元素。 我最初将堆栈弹出两次到 eax,因为我想要 argc,这样我就可以计算 argc 的数量。然后
我正在学习 CS50 的 Python 编程简介。对于当前的问题,我应该编写一个程序,其中涉及: 需要零或两个命令行参数: 泽...
哪个更高效、更有效 - sys.argv 或 argparse? [已关闭]
寻找关于什么更好地用于脚本命令行参数的想法和/或意见(特别是在命令行调用函数): sys.argv 还是 argparse? 例子: user1# ./myscr...
How to pass a numbers list to function using command line sys.argv Python3 [重复]
我想使用 sys.argv[] 从命令行获取 5 个数字的列表到函数 (def calc_avg),以便对它们进行平均。但我不断收到 - TypeError: int() argument must be a string, a b...
我试图理解 argc 和 argv,所以我尝试打印它们的内容,但我遇到了一些奇怪的事情
这是代码,它按预期运行。 ` #include ` int main( int argc, char* argv[]) { printf (" 这是 argc 的内容:%d ",argc); ...
我有一个奇怪的问题。 我正在使用 exec 从另一个 PHP 页面(第 1 页)中“触发”一个 PHP 页面(第 2 页),它将 $argv 变量发送到第 2 页。 问题是,p 上的数据库连接...
“Segmentation fault(core dumped)”(argv 问题)
所以我尝试调试它,我知道它与 argv 有关,但我不确定发生了什么。 #包括 #包括 #包括 #包括 ...
所以我尝试调试它,我知道它与 argv 有关,但我不确定发生了什么。 #包括 #包括 #包括 #包括 ...
我一直在尝试获取 argv 中所有字符串的长度,而无需在 C/C++ 中迭代 argv。 我知道你可以这样做: 对于 (; argv; ++argv, length += strlen(*argv)); 是不是...